1. Understanding the Job Search App Landscape

1.1. Why Build a Job Search App?

A job search app lets you connect employers and candidates seamlessly. These apps can enhance hiring efficiency, reach niche markets, and create unique revenue opportunities.

  • Employers benefit by streamlining the candidate discovery process.
  • Job seekers get personalized recommendations and access to exclusive opportunities.

1.2. Key Market Insights

Successful apps like LinkedIn, Glassdoor, and Indeed dominate the global market, but there’s room for improvement in:

  • Hyper-local or industry-specific hiring.
  • Better candidate-job matches using AI.
  • Improved employer branding and messaging tools.

2. Planning Your Job Search App

2.1. Define Your Niche

Identify a specific audience or challenge to address. Examples:

  • Target a specific industry (e.g., healthcare, tech).
  • Offer tools for remote-first hiring.
  • Focus on entry-level jobs for college graduates.

2.2. List Core Features

Your app must include:

  • Profiles: For job seekers and employers.
  • Search Filters: Sort by location, salary, and job type.
  • In-App Messaging: Improve employer-candidate communication.
  • Application Tracker: Help employers and candidates track hiring progress.
  • Notifications: Keep users updated on opportunities or candidate responses.

2.3. Monetization Models

  1. Freemium: Basic listings for free; charge for premium tools.
  2. Subscription Plans: Tiered pricing for job seekers or employers.
  3. Sponsored Listings: Promote job posts for extra visibility.

3. Cost Breakdown for Development

3.1. Key Cost Elements

  • MVP (Minimal Viable Product): $15,000–$40,000.
  • Full-scale app: $50,000–$150,000.
  • Third-party integrations: $5,000–$20,000 for payment gateways or messaging tools.

3.2. Factors Affecting Cost

  • Scope of features.
  • Region of the development team (e.g., US teams may cost more than offshore).
  • Post-launch maintenance, averaging 15–20% of the development cost annually.

4. Choosing the Right Technology Stack

4.1. Frontend Technology

  • React Native or Flutter for cross-platform compatibility.
  • Faster builds and easier updates.

4.2. Backend Technology

  • Node.js: For scalable and fast operations.
  • Django or Ruby on Rails: Simplifies backend tasks for startups.

4.3. Cloud and Data

  • AWS, Google Cloud, or Microsoft Azure: Reliable hosting services.
  • PostgreSQL or MongoDB: Manage databases effectively.

4.4. Leveraging AI

  • Implement AI for personalized job recommendations and smart filters.
  • TensorFlow or scikit-learn can support algorithm development.

7. How to Market Your App

7.1. Pre-Launch Steps

  • Run beta tests to refine features.
  • Optimize for app stores with high-ranking keywords.
  • Build a website or landing page to create interest.

7.2. Go-To-Market Strategy

  • Social Media Advertising: Leverage platforms like LinkedIn and Facebook.
  • Partnerships: Collaborate with HR firms and universities.
  • Referral Programs: Incentivize users to share the app.

8. Post-Launch Growth Strategies

8.1. Enhancing the User Experience

  • Gather user feedback regularly.
  • Add requested features in updates (e.g., video interviews or detailed analytics).

8.2. Measuring Success

Track KPIs like:

  • Daily and monthly active users.
  • Retention rates.
  • Revenue from subscriptions or ads.
